Step-by-Step Guide to Buying Floki Inu
Create an Exchange Account
The first step is to create an account on a cryptocurrency exchange that lists FLOKI. This typically involves providing an email address and creating a secure password. After registration, enhance your account security by enabling two-factor authentication.
Complete Identity Verification
Most regulated exchanges require users to complete a Know Your Customer (KYC) process. This usually involves submitting a government-issued ID and sometimes a selfie for verification. This step is essential for enabling fiat currency deposits and withdrawals and for increasing account security.
Deposit Funds
Once your account is verified, you need to deposit funds. Exchanges generally offer several options:
- Fiat Currency Deposit: Use a bank transfer, credit card, or debit card to deposit traditional currency like USD, EUR, or GBP.
- Cryptocurrency Deposit: Transfer an existing cryptocurrency, such as USDT or USDC, from an external wallet to your exchange wallet.
Execute the Purchase
Navigate to the trading section of the exchange—often labeled "Spot Trading" or "Buy Crypto." Search for the FLOKI trading pair that matches your deposit currency (e.g., FLOKI/USDT or FLOKI/USDC). Enter the amount of FLOKI you wish to purchase, review the transaction details, and confirm the order. The FLOKI tokens will then be credited to your exchange wallet.
Secure Your FLOKI Tokens

Best Practices for Storing Floki Inu Securely
Proper storage is critical for protecting your cryptocurrency investments.
- Hot Wallets: These are software-based wallets (mobile, desktop, or web) connected to the internet. They offer convenience for frequent trading but are more vulnerable to online threats.
- Cold Wallets: These are physical devices (hardware wallets) or paper wallets that store your private keys offline. They provide the highest level of security for long-term storage of significant amounts of crypto.
Remember, cryptocurrency wallets don't "store" coins themselves; they secure the private keys that grant you access to your assets on the blockchain.

What is Floki Inu (FLOKI)?
Floki Inu is a community-driven cryptocurrency token inspired by popular meme culture. Launched in 2021, it operates on the Ethereum blockchain and aims to develop a full utility ecosystem including NFTs, DeFi products, and a metaverse presence.

What are the fees involved in buying FLOKI?
Fees can vary by platform but typically include deposit fees (for card payments or bank transfers), trading fees (a small percentage of the transaction value), and potential network (gas) fees for withdrawing tokens to a private wallet. Always check the fee schedule on your chosen exchange.
